That's because singapore's national flower is the vanda miss joaquim orchid and it stands as a proud symbol of singapore's identity as a garden city A committee was formed to pick a flower that would make people proud and reflect singapore’s identity. The vanda miss joaquim was the very first hybrid orchid cultivated in singapore by miss agnes joaquim in 1893, who grew it in her garden.

Papilionanthe miss joaquim, also known as the singapore orchid, the princess aloha orchid, and commonly known by its original name vanda miss joaquim, is a hybrid orchid (a grex) that is the national flower of singapore In 1981, singapore chose the vanda miss joaquim orchid as its national flower Orchids, with their exotic beauty and captivating forms, hold a special place in the hearts of singaporeans

More than just a beautiful flower, they are a symbol of national pride and cultural heritage, woven into the very fabric of singaporean society.

The vanda miss joaquim orchid was officially launched as singapore’s national flower on 15 april 1981 Like a flower bouquet that conveys heartfelt sentiments, the orchid became a symbol of singapore's unity in diversity Just as each petal in a bouquet brings a distinct charm, singapore embraces its multicultural populace.
